WebHumans can also experience severe reactions when stung by paper wasps. Wasps can sting repeatedly; causing pain, swelling and whole-body effects that can trigger allergic reactions that may result in death. To avoid their stings, leave the immediate area and don’t swat or squash wasps. A dead bee cannot sting you, its dead. IF you tramp on, squeeze, pinch a bee ( even if it is dead) and the stinger is able to puncture your skin then it will sting. The stinger does not hold the venom, the venom sac within the bee does.
